Ed O'Connor ----- Original Message ----- From: "Renee Cummings" <rcummi1123@rogers.com> To: "edoc" <edoc@prodigy.net> Sent: Friday, September 03, 2004 8:49 AM Subject: RE: [QUEBEC] Marriage record, Saint Pie de Bagot, 1839, Mackie/Chicoine > > Here is how send for a record > For BMD records prior to 1900 from the archives. > You send along a cheque for $2.00 (same for the US) for up to FOUR > documents, or you can wait to receive them and bill at that time, made to > Le Mininstre des Finances. > You can write in English or French. > This is for records prior to 1900 > Here is a sample of what you can write to: > Archives Nationales du Québec > 535, av. Thank you for your help. > Sincerely > XXXXXXXXXXX > your address > I also include my e-mail address just in case. > --------------- > They will conduct a 1/2 hour search only so give them as much info as you > can. If you have too many they may not have the time to find them all so > better split them in request of no more than 6 per letter. > They might even find some people you didn't ask for or didn't know about. > They are very good at it, but be patient it could take a couple of months > for a reply. > Give them all the info that you can,,,dit names, different spelling an > approximate time, places all that you think could be!!! > And when they didn't find anything, believe it or not they send me my money > back... > Good luck Take care > Renée > those are for records before 1900 only > ============================ > These are the different branches you can write to. > Adresses pour les Archives nationales du Québec > These are the addresses for the many different branches for the QUEBEC > NATIONAL ARCHIVES!. > http://www.anq.gouv.qc.ca/ANQ-F.html > > Les Archives nationales du Québec offrent leurs services sur tout le > territoire québécois grâce à un réseau de neuf centres régionaux.
